Feel free to write if you have any questions. Discover this vintage Curteichcolor postcard showcasing the iconic Devil's Den at the Gettysburg Battlefield in Pennsylvania. This historic site, renowned for its role in the American Civil War, is depicted with its distinctive rock formations, where Confederate sharpshooters strategically positioned themselves against Union forces defending Little Round Top. The vivid natural color reproduction captures the rugged landscape and lush greenery surrounding this pivotal location. Produced by Curt Teich & Co. and created specifically for the Gettysburg National Museum, this postcard is a testament to the detailed Curteichcolor 3-D Natural Color Reproduction process. It offers a glimpse into the mid-20th century representation of a significant historical landmark, appealing to collectors of Americana, Civil War memorabilia, and Pennsylvania history.
